The CCIE Data Center certification is one of the most prestigious credentials in the networking world. It validates expert-level knowledge of complex data center solutions, including networking, storage networking, automation, and orchestration. Earning this certification requires dedication, practical experience, and access to the best resources. If you’re preparing for the CCIE Data Center exam, here’s a curated list of the top 10 books and resources to help you succeed.

1. CCIE Data Center Official Cert Guide, Volumes 1 & 2 (2nd Edition) – Cisco Press

These are the foundational books for anyone preparing for the CCIE Data Center written exam. Authored by Cisco experts, these volumes cover core topics like data center networking, NX-OS, storage networking, and application-centric infrastructure (ACI).Why it’s essential: It provides structured learning aligned with Cisco’s exam blueprint, with chapter reviews and practice questions.

2. NX-OS and Cisco Nexus Switching: Next-Generation Data Center Architectures – Cisco Press

This book is an in-depth guide to Cisco Nexus platforms and the NX-OS operating system. It covers Layer 2/3 switching, virtualization, security, and troubleshooting.Why it’s valuable: It goes beyond certification topics and offers real-world design considerations and configuration examples.

3. Cisco ACI Cookbook – Packt Publishing

If you’re new to Cisco ACI (Application Centric Infrastructure), this book provides step-by-step guidance and practical recipes to deploy, configure, and troubleshoot ACI environments.Why it’s helpful: It simplifies complex ACI configurations and helps bridge the gap between theory and practice.

4. Data Center Virtualization Fundamentals – Cisco Press

This resource is ideal for mastering foundational technologies like virtualization, UCS, and converged infrastructure.Why it’s important: It builds a strong conceptual base for understanding how physical and virtual environments interact in the data center.

5. Cisco UCS Cookbook – Packt Publishing

The Unified Computing System (UCS) is a crucial component of the CCIE DC track. This book offers practical tips and tricks for configuring and managing UCS infrastructure.Why it’s beneficial: UCS can be daunting without hands-on experience, and this book brings much-needed clarity.

6. Cisco Documentation and Configuration Guides (Cisco.com)

Cisco's official documentation is often overlooked but is one of the most up-to-date and comprehensive sources of technical information.Why it’s critical: It reflects real-world usage and configuration syntax that may be asked in the lab exam.

7. INE CCIE Data Center Learning Path

INE is known for its high-quality training videos, workbooks, and rack rentals. The CCIE DC track includes comprehensive courses on topics like FabricPath, OTV, VXLAN, ACI, and UCS.Why it’s worth it: The video training helps visualize complex topologies, and labs reinforce hands-on skills.

8. Cisco Modeling Labs (CML) or EVE-NG

These platforms allow you to build and simulate your own data center topologies using virtual Cisco devices.Why you need it: Hands-on practice is a must for CCIE success. These tools offer a cost-effective way to lab up scenarios.

9. Cisco Live On-Demand Library

Cisco Live offers thousands of free technical sessions recorded from live events. You can access in-depth sessions on every technology covered in the CCIE DC blueprint.Why it’s useful: Sessions are presented by Cisco engineers and give real-world insights and future trends.

10. Reddit and Tech Community Forums

Communities like r/ccie, Cisco Learning Network, and TechExams are goldmines for tips, feedback, and support from fellow candidates and certified professionals.Why it’s underrated: You get real-time help, motivational success stories, and updates about the exam format or lab changes.
